When Will Railways Launch Vande Bharat Sleeper Trains? Minister Ashwini Vaishnaw Says...
A train is ready for launch at Shakur Basti Coaching Depot in Delhi after completing essential trials testing, PTI reported citing officials.
Vaishnaw mentioned that the second train is currently in production and might be completed by October 15, 2025.
"Both the trains will be launched together," he said while briefing the media.
The minister highlighted that the second train is crucial for maintaining the continuity of regular services.

There is widespread speculation that the trains will be introduced between New Delhi and Patna, as Bihar prepares for elections later this year.
Railway projects in PunjabThe minister's statement comes as Vaishnaw , together with Minister of State for Railways Ravneet Singh Bittu, provided an update to the media on the current and future railway projects in Punjab.
They informed that the upcoming 18-kilometre Rajpura-Mohali line will link the area to Chandigarh through the shortest route along the Ambala-Amritsar main line.

It is also expected to ease traffic on the existing Rajpura-Ambala route and shorten the Ambala-Morinda link.
Vaishnaw mentioned that the Railway Ministry plans to introduce a new Vande Bharat train connecting New Delhi and Firozpur Cantonment. The route will include stations such as Faridkot, Bhatinda (W), Dhuri, Patiala, Ambala Cantonment, Kurukshetra, and Panipat.

"I will request the Prime Minister to approve the Firozpur-Delhi Vande Bharat train," Vaishnaw said.
The ministers announced nine significant railway projects that have been commissioned since 2014.

Seven railway projects, including Nangal Dam-Talwara new line, Bhanupalli-Bilaspur-Beri new line, Ferozpur-Patti new line, and the doubling of Mansa-Bhatinda line, Ludhiana-Kila Raipur line, Ludhiana-Mullanpur line and Alal-Himmatana line were introduced.
